软件学院实践与毕业设计指引(2020 春版 专科)
按照“软件学院实践与毕业设计实施方案”,根据当前学期的实际开课情况,制订本指引。
本指引(2020 春版) 自 2020 春季学期起启用,到后续制订发布新的指引止均按本指引 组织实施。
一、本指引适用以下专业与课程
1、移动互联应用技术(移动互联网应用技术) 专业
二、选题与评分标准
1.1 选题一
基于 Android 开发一个完整的天气预报系统, 包括手机 App 端和服务器端。现有的 4G/5G 技术和移动互联网技术的快速发展,智能手机功能的不断增强,让基于 Android 平台 的查询需求越来越多。本系统就是利用现有的网络快速获取网络上的天气信息并显示到手机 终端上,为用户提供实时的天气查询和近期天气查询服务,为工作、出行等带来便利。通过 服务器接口开发等技术让用户体验到前所未有的移动计算。
本题目要求完成天气预报系统架构图, 以及界面设计,包括:启动界面;设置界面:对 要显示天气预报的城市及更新频率进行设置;显示界面:通过文字和图片显示当前的天气情 况,包括日期、时间、城市、最高温度、最低温度、当前温度等;详细界面:在显示出“显示 界面”上所有信息的同时用列表的形式显示当天的天气情况。
1.2 选题二
基于 Android 开发一个完整的天气预报系统, 包括手机 App 端和服务器端。现有的 4G/5G 技术和移动互联网技术的快速发展,智能手机功能的不断增强,让基于 Android 平台 的查询需求越来越多。本系统就是利用现有的网络快速获取网络上的天气信息并显示到手机 终端上,为用户提供实时的天气查询和近期天气查询服务,为工作、出行等带来便利。通过 服务器接口开发等技术让用户体验到前所未有的移动计算。
本题目要求完成天气预报系统架构图,以及数据库设计。本系统有两部分数据需要存储, 一个是显示页面的数据,另一个是详细页面的数据。但是数据量都不是很大,因此可以选择 SQLite 数据库作为存储数据的方法,建立数据库,并且建立两张表 widget 和 forecast,分别
存储显示页面的数据和详细页面的数据。
1.3 选题三
基于 Android 开发一个完整的天气预报系统, 包括手机 App 端和服务器端。现有的 4G/5G 技术和移动互联网技术的快速发展,智能手机功能的不断增强,让基于 Android 平台 的查询需求越来越多。本系统就是利用现有的网络快速获取网络上的天气信息并显示到手机 终端上,为用户提供实时的天气查询和近期天气查询服务,为工作、出行等带来便利。通过 服务器接口开发等技术让用户体验到前所未有的移动计算。
本题目要求完成天气预报系统架构图,以及功能模块设计。从功能需求进行分析可以看 出,整个应用程序应划分为 4 个模块,分别是程序启动、用户界面、后台服务和数据库适配 器。
1.4 评分标准
完成情况
|
评分
|
完成天气预报系统架构图,完成题目要求的设计或功能模块设计全部功
能(代码或运行截图皆可)
|
90-100 分
|
题目要求的设计或功能模块设计全部功能(代码或运行截图皆可)
|
80-90 分
|
题目要求的功能模块设计或界面设计或数据库设计缺一项减 10 分(代
码或运行截图皆可)
|
80 分以下
|
题目要求的设计全部未完成
|
0 分
|
2.1 选题一
基于 Android 系统开发一个具备基本功能的电商网购系统,包括手 App 端和服务器端。 基本功能应包括商品列表、详情页、购物车、订单管理等手机端功能, 以及服务器端的商品 信息管理、订单管理等功能。本题目要求完成系统架构图、详细功能设计文档、以及以下功 能的 UI 设计:
1、 启动引导页和欢迎页。
2、 主页商品分类展示。
3、 点击商品进入该书详情页。
4、 详情页可选择数量并加入购物车。
5、 购物车可删除某商品, 并批量下单, 进度条显示下单过程。
6、 订单页展示和删除。
7、个人详情页展示个人信息, 并提供修改密码和切换账号功能。
8、 侧导航可登录和注销登录。
9、登录页注册账号。
2.2 选题二
基于 Android 系统开发一个具备基本功能的电商网购系统,包括手 App 端和服务器端。 基本功能应包括商品列表、详情页、购物车、订单管理等手机端功能, 以及服务器端的商品 信息管理、订单管理等功能。本题目要求完成系统架构图、详细功能设计文档、以及以下功 能的代码编写:
1、 启动引导页和欢迎页。
2、 主页商品分类展示。
3、 点击商品进入该书详情页。
4、 详情页可选择数量并加入购物车。
5、 购物车可删除某商品, 并批量下单, 进度条显示下单过程。
6、 订单页展示和删除。
7、 个人详情页展示个人信息, 并提供修改密码和切换账号功能。
8、 侧导航可登录和注销登录。
9、 登录页注册账号。
2.3 选题三
基于 Android 系统开发一个具备基本功能的电商网购系统,包括手 App 端和服务器端。 基本功能应包括商品列表、详情页、购物车、订单管理等手机端功能, 以及服务器端的商品 信息管理、订单管理等功能。本题目要求完成系统架构图、详细功能设计文档、以及服务器 端数据库设计及接口代码代码, 数据库类型不限。
2.4 评分标准
完成情况
|
评分
|
完成系统架构图、详细功能设计文档、题目要求的设计或功能模块设计全
部功能(代码或运行截图皆可)
|
90-100 分
|
详细功能设计文档、题目要求的设计或功能模块设计全部功能(代码或运
行截图皆可)
|
80-90 分
|
题目要求的设计或功能模块设计全部功能(代码或运行截图皆可)
|
70-80 分
|
题目要求的功能模块设计或界面设计或数据库设计缺一项减 10 分(代码
或运行截图皆可)
|
70 分以下
|
题目要求的设计全部未完成
|
0 分
|